Point Cook P-9 College has a Bring Your Own Device (BYOD) Program from Prep to Year 9. The BYOD Program means families are requested to supply a device for their own child. It is not compulsory; however, we encourage all families to participate.
It is important that you understand that the device does not replace traditional pen and paper activities. We still believe there is a place for these tools today and in the future. The device is used during certain times in the day and when needed to support student learning. Students will continue to interact with each other face-to-face during class times.
We are continuously seeing the benefits that the 1:1 program can bring to broadening student learning, digital competencies, increased student choice and the personalisation of learning for our students.
Our Acceptable Use Agreement (AUA) is reviewed annually. This process is completed via a digital link sent out to Parents/Guardians via email.
